An explanation of the concept of catharsis, as the term was originally used by Aristotle in his Poetics. Including Aristotle's defense of poetry as a means to purge the emotions of fear and pity, the four ways to give rise to fear and pity (knowingly, unknowingly, completed and interrupted).
